Video Touch - Wild Animals is an education app developed by SoundTouch Interactive. The last update, v3.22, released on March 16, 2022, and it’s rated 4.94 out of 5 based on the latest 17 reviews. Video Touch - Wild Animals costs $2.99 and requires iOS 8.0+ and Android 7 or newer to download.

★★★★★Love this series of apps!
This app and it's 5 companion apps are some of the best apps for the youngest of iDevice users. My 2 year old and 4 year old love these apps. Perfect and simple! Your child will be given a grid of icons that correlate to the chosen app (in this case lions, and tigers, and bears, etc). They choose an icon and they get to watch a continuous (no fast cuts!) clip of the chosen icon. Watch the TED Talk on kids watching shows with fast cuts to learn why that is NOT a good thing.
